How they compare
Kazakhstan currently reports 1.96 % change on previous year against 1.9 % change on previous year in Bosnia and Herzegovina, a difference of 0.06 % change on previous year.
The two have swapped places 13 times across 125 shared years of data; in 1891 it was Bosnia and Herzegovina ahead.
Bosnia and Herzegovina ranks 147th and Kazakhstan ranks 144th of 215 countries.
Across the 14 decades both report, Bosnia and Herzegovina averaged higher in 10 and Kazakhstan in 4.
Head to head by decade
| Decade | Bosnia and Herzegovina | Kazakhstan | Difference | Ahead |
|---|---|---|---|---|
| 1890s | 45.87 % change on previous year | 9.69 % change on previous year | 36.18 % change on previous year | Bosnia and Herzegovina |
| 1900s | 15.88 % change on previous year | 8.03 % change on previous year | 7.85 % change on previous year | Bosnia and Herzegovina |
| 1910s | 13 % change on previous year | 6.44 % change on previous year | 6.56 % change on previous year | Bosnia and Herzegovina |
| 1920s | 14.31 % change on previous year | 2.4 % change on previous year | 11.91 % change on previous year | Bosnia and Herzegovina |
| 1930s | 6.56 % change on previous year | 6.93 % change on previous year | 0.3764 % change on previous year | Kazakhstan |
| 1940s | 5.09 % change on previous year | 5.81 % change on previous year | 0.7195 % change on previous year | Kazakhstan |
| 1950s | 6.51 % change on previous year | 7.09 % change on previous year | 0.5863 % change on previous year | Kazakhstan |
| 1960s | 6.84 % change on previous year | 6.66 % change on previous year | 0.1823 % change on previous year | Bosnia and Herzegovina |
| 1970s | 6.82 % change on previous year | 5.75 % change on previous year | 1.07 % change on previous year | Bosnia and Herzegovina |
| 1980s | 5.27 % change on previous year | 4.45 % change on previous year | 0.8182 % change on previous year | Bosnia and Herzegovina |
| 1990s | 2.01 % change on previous year | 2.42 % change on previous year | 0.4137 % change on previous year | Kazakhstan |
| 2000s | 2.56 % change on previous year | 1.96 % change on previous year | 0.5987 % change on previous year | Bosnia and Herzegovina |
| 2010s | 2.6 % change on previous year | 2.37 % change on previous year | 0.2345 % change on previous year | Bosnia and Herzegovina |
| 2020s | 2.08 % change on previous year | 1.95 % change on previous year | 0.133 % change on previous year | Bosnia and Herzegovina |
Averages of every year both report within each decade.
